Merrill Community Bank- 2019 Small Business of the Year

MERRILL, WI – Merrill Community Bank has been selected as the 2019 Small Business of the Year and received their award from Merrill Area Chamber of Commerce at their Annual Awards Celebration.
Merrill Federal Savings and Loan Association was formed as a mutual corporation in October 1940 by a handful of Merrill residents for the sole purpose of providing home ownership to area residents. They started in a small office located at 925 East Main Street and then purchased and moved to their current location at 907 E. Main Street in December 1953. They purchased the adjacent building for additional space in 1978.
In 2016, Merrill Federal Savings and Loan merged with Tomahawk Community Bank and became Merrill Community Bank. Similar to Tomahawk Community Bank, when Merrill Federal Savings and Loan was charted, there was no intent by its organizers to personally profit by the organization. The merger of the two institutions insured an independent banking philosophy in terms of local lending decisions and other financial products continuing at both the Tomahawk and Merrill locations. Both institutions are committed to “Community Banking without Boundaries”, by serving the needs of our area communities.
“The institution has been a long-time investing member of the Merrill Area Chamber of Commerce,” Debbe Kinsey, Chamber President & CEO. “But they are more than that, they are a great corporate citizen sponsoring and donating to events and activities in Merrill. They donated a portion of the land that is now Banker’s Square Pocket Park and partnered with our Chamber Foundation to complete a mural on the wall beneath the bank wall.”
And just like the great Christmas movie, “It’s A Wonderful Life”, the old savings and loan is still alive and well, just under a new name – Merrill Community Bank.
